The marble mosaic floor in Siena Cathedral, in Italy, has been unveiled. The floor, created between the 14th and 16th centuries, is usually covered, to protect the fragile surface. The floor is on show until the end of the month, and from 18 August to 18 October, The Art Newspaper reports. The floor is covered with 56 inlaid marble squares, covering 1300m²
